Output c31f2f24b7e3366b8ccb5cf290c0f8ea2a61da6c19a3ef845a61937c20aa36ef:0

value
6600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4206910f7b42ef1440baf6ac24722d8027c4245f OP_EQUAL
address
37i8PToP37S73f5dxb8paHNdJMN5QA8M68
transaction
c31f2f24b7e3366b8ccb5cf290c0f8ea2a61da6c19a3ef845a61937c20aa36ef
confirmations
85701
spent
true